Understanding trigeminal neuralgia treatments requires deep knowledge of brainstem and spinal nuclei anatomy and physiology. This review covers recent neuroscience advances in these complex structures and their autonomic effects.

Area of Science:

  • Neuroscience
  • Anatomy
  • Physiology

Background:

  • Trigeminal neuralgia treatments necessitate comprehensive understanding of neuroanatomy and neurophysiology.
  • Knowledge of brainstem and spinal nuclei, trigeminal autonomic pathways, and injury effects is crucial.

Purpose of the Study:

  • To review recent advances in the anatomical and physiological understanding of the trigeminal system.
  • To consolidate current knowledge relevant to trigeminal neuralgia treatment.

Main Methods:

  • Literature review of neuroscience research.
  • Synthesis of information on brainstem and spinal nuclei anatomy and physiology.
  • Analysis of trigeminal nerve connections and autonomic elements.

Main Results:

  • Detailed review of trigeminal nerve anatomy, including central and peripheral connections.
  • Explanation of the physiology of brainstem and spinal nuclei.
  • Discussion of trigeminal autonomic elements and autonomic effects of trigeminal injury.

Conclusions:

  • Current understanding of trigeminal system anatomy and physiology is essential for effective treatment of trigeminal neuralgia.
  • Recent advances highlight the complexity and interconnectedness of the trigeminal system.
  • Further research into the neurobiological underpinnings can improve therapeutic strategies.
